MEN’S CITY BRANCH.
A meeting of the committe of the Men’s City branch of the Red Cross Society was held on Wednesday. It was resolved that Miesara A. S. Nicholls, W. J. Wood, J. 8. Barrett and* J. O. Jameson should be added tc the committee. It was further resolved l that the oity should be canvassed for aubsoriptidns to the fund with the object of providing money for the purchase of material to be distributed 1 free of charge at the rooms obtained by the committee in.
